Coconut Charcoal

Coconut charcoal is a type of charcoal that is made from coconut shells. It is commonly used for cooking and grilling due to its high heat output and low smoke production.

Key Features

  • Made from coconut shells
  • High heat output
  • Low smoke production
  • Environmentally friendly

Pros

  • Burns hotter and cleaner than regular charcoal
  • Renewable source of fuel
  • Does not contain chemicals or additives

Cons

  • May be more expensive than regular charcoal
  • Harder to find in some regions
